Maura’s recent work and talk will be about the flora of Macquarie Island – the world’s southernmost plant growing environment – and her project as a recipient of an Australian Antarctic Arts Fellowship, which resulted in an exhibition and the book Saving Macquarie Island launching in May 2026.
Maura is a botanical artist working in Lutruwita/Tasmania. She trained at the Chelsea School of Botanical Illustration, Chelsea Physic Garden, London graduating in 2018. Maura returned to live in Tasmania, her childhood home, in early 2020. Her interest is in endemic and native species in their original locations.
